Biography

A/Profesor Kathryn Panaretto is a Public Health Physician with a background in primary care with major interests in Indigenous health & improving health service delivery. She is a vocationally registered GP & member of the RACGP, completing an MPH at James Cook University in 2001 & Fellowship (Australian Faculty of Public Health Medicine) in 2006.
